3-Isocyanatopropyltriethoxysilane, with its CAS number 24801-88-5, is a unique organosilicon compound that acts as both a coupling agent and an adhesion promoter. Its dual functionality stems from the presence of both an isocyanate group and a triethoxysilane group. The triethoxysilane portion can hydrolyze to form silanols, which then bond with inorganic substrates, while the isocyanate group readily reacts with active hydrogen-containing compounds found in many organic polymers and resins. This dual action creates a strong bridge between dissimilar materials, leading to significantly improved adhesion and overall coating integrity.
The application of 3-Isocyanatopropyltriethoxysilane in coatings is extensive. It is particularly effective in enhancing the adhesion of coatings to challenging substrates such as metals, glass, and plastics. By improving the interfacial bonding, it contributes to better mechanical properties, increased resistance to environmental factors like moisture and chemicals, and improved long-term performance. Formulators often seek such silane coupling agents to achieve enhanced composite material performance and to improve the wetting and dispersibility of fillers within the coating matrix.
